The State Duma urged not to publish a video of the operation of air defense systems

Andrey Svintsov, Deputy Chairman of the Information Policy Committee, urged the Russians not to post videos on the Internet with their work on air defense systems (air defense). Portal reports “To climb”.

At the same time, the deputy noted that he does not consider it a legal act to punish citizens for posting such videos.

“Otherwise, we will come to punish innocent people who spread this a bit stupidly,” Svintsov said.

The deputy said that in current conditions, air defense systems can be seen from the highway on the Novorizhskoye Highway – they are located at a distance of five to ten kilometers from each other. Numerous air defense systems have also been installed in the regions of Russia bordering Ukraine.

With a similar request the previous day, discussed Mikhail Podolyak, adviser to the head of the office of the President of Ukraine. He reminded authorities and bloggers that information on the operation of air defense systems in combat conditions cannot be published.

On February 24, 2022, Russian President Vladimir Putin announced that he had decided to organize a special military operation in Ukraine in response to a request for assistance from the heads of the LPR and DPR.

The decision to run the operation became the justification for new sanctions against Russia by the United States and its allies.
